24 FOR THE 24th OF MAY - SEEKING OUT THE BEST LAMB DISHES ACROSS NZ

Thursday 24 May is National Lamb Day which celebrates one of the most significant milestones in New Zealand’s sheep meat history, marking the day the first shipment of lamb arrived in London, 98 days after leaving Port Chalmers.  As a nation we love to celebrate New Zealand’s great achievements, so we encourage you to get out and enjoy lamb whichever way you can on National Lamb Day.

If dining out is your way to celebrate, then we have taken the guess work out of finding an award-winning lamb dish for you to try on National Lamb Day. We begin our lamb journey at the bottom of the South Island where the first shipment left New Zealand all those years ago and take you right up to tropical Northland.  So, wherever you will be on National Lamb Day we have 24 suggestions for you to celebrate on 24 May.

The Duke of Marlborough Hotel – Russell, Bay of Islands

The town of Russell is nestled in the Bay of Islands and was the first permanent European settlement and sea port in New Zealand. It is now a popular holiday destination and bastion of cafes, gifts shops and B&B’s.  Catching the ferry from Pahia to Russell is a short 15 minute journey and allows you to take in all the beauty that surrounds the Bay. As you jump off the ferry and walk down the pier you can see the Duke of Marlborough Hotel just to the left, behind the Pohutukawa trees and you are immediately attracted to the hustle and bustle of the hotel.

A COLLABORATION OF AMBASSADOR CHEFS

There are many provinces around New Zealand who are creating a real foodie following and the Manawatu would have to be one of them.  The area not only boasts many Beef and Lamb Excellence Award holders who are dishing up excellent beef and lamb cuisine, but it is home to the annual Plate of Origin competition.  This is a collaboration between a Manawatu based restaurant and a restaurant from another region of New Zealand.
